Who will you be supporting?
At Fiennes House we support 12 adults with a range of disabilities including learning and physical disabilities, sight loss, complex health conditions including epilepsy, cerebral palsy and autism. 
People at Wellington location are a very active group who enjoy going out for fun activities such as day trips to the seaside or to music concerts, bowling, and discos. They also watch movies, love cooking/baking (and tasting the end result!), gardening for the lovely smells from the herbs and flowers, foot spa and pamper sessions, sensory sessions and stories.
They also enjoy the comfort of their own home, each bedroom has a fully accessible ensuite bathroom, we also have a separate jacuzzi bath.
